Former President Joe Biden has been seen with a noticeable scar on his forehead following a recent health procedure. The 82-year-old leader underwent Mohs surgery to remove cancerous skin cells, which left him with a sizable mark on the right side of his forehead. A video recorded during a church visit on September 24, 2023, captured the scar, prompting public interest and concern.

The procedure is a common treatment for skin cancer, renowned for its effectiveness in excising malignancies while preserving healthy tissue. According to medical experts, Mohs surgery typically involves removing skin cancer layer by layer, examining each layer microscopically until no cancerous cells remain. This approach minimizes scarring and maximizes the chances of complete cancer removal.
